[
    {
        "role": "user",
        "content": "I%20hear%20there%20is%20a%20new%20model%20from%20google%20called%20gema%20I%20think%20for%20local%20work.%20what%20are%20its%20system%20requirements%2C%20ram%2C%20cpu%2C%20gpu"
    },
    {
        "role": "assistant",
        "content": "Here\u2019s a breakdown of *Gemma* (by Google DeepMind) \u2014 especially the new **Gemma 4** model family \u2014 and what it takes to run them *locally*. Depending on the size, you\u2019ll need different amounts of VRAM, system RAM, and CPU/GPU capability.\n\n---\n\n## What is Gemma?\n\n- Gemma is a family of **source-available (and now with Gemma 4, Apache 2.0\u2013licensed)** language models from Google DeepMind. It\u2019s designed to be a lighter/smaller open version of Gemini. ([en.wikipedia.org](https://en.wikipedia.org/wiki/Gemma_%28language_model%29?utm_source=openai))  \n- Model sizes vary significantly: from ~2\u20137 billion parameters in Gemma 1 & 2, through 1B-27B in Gemma 3, to four distinct sizes in Gemma 4: **E2B, E4B, 26B MoE, 31B Dense**. ([en.wikipedia.org](https://en.wikipedia.org/wiki/Gemma_%28language_model%29?utm_source=openai))  \n\n---\n\n## Gemma 4: Size Charactertistics & Features\n\nHere are key specs for the four Gemma 4 variants: ([gemmai4.com](https://gemmai4.com/specs/?utm_source=openai))\n\n| Model | Type | Effective / Total Params | Context Window | Supports Modalities |\n|---|---|---|---|---|\n| **E2B** | Dense; \u201cedge-leaning\u201d | ~2.3B effective (5.1B with embeddings) | 128K tokens | Text, image, audio ([gemmai4.com](https://gemmai4.com/specs/?utm_source=openai)) |\n| **E4B** | Dense; more balanced | ~4.5B effective (8B with embeddings) | 128K | Text, image, audio ([gemmai4.com](https://gemmai4.com/specs/?utm_source=openai)) |\n| **26B MoE (A4B)** | Mixture-of-Experts | 25-26B total, ~3.8B active per inference | 256K | Text, image ([gemmai4.com](https://gemmai4.com/specs/?utm_source=openai)) |\n| **31B Dense** | Dense flagship-style | ~30.7B | 256K | Text, image ([gemmai4.com](https://gemmai4.com/specs/?utm_source=openai)) |\n\n---\n\n## Local Hardware Requirements (CPU, RAM, GPU/VRAM)\n\nThese depend heavily on:\n\n- model size (E2B, E4B, 26B MoE, 31B Dense)  \n- numerical precision / quantization (e.g. FP16, BF16, or \u201cquantized\u201d = 4- or 8-bit)  \n- context window size (short vs very long)  \n- whether inference is done via GPU, on Apple Silicon, or CPU\u2013only  \n\nHere are up-to-date estimates as of **April 2026**: ([compute-market.com](https://www.compute-market.com/blog/gemma-4-local-hardware-guide-2026?utm_source=openai))\n\n---\n\n### VRAM (GPU memory) by Model & Precision\n\n| Model | Q4 Quantization (4-bit) | Q8 Quantization (8-bit) | BF16 / Full Precision |\n|---|---|---|---|\n| **E2B (2-3B)** | ~1.5-3 GB | ~2.2-5 GB | ~4-5 GB ([compute-market.com](https://www.compute-market.com/blog/gemma-4-local-hardware-guide-2026?utm_source=openai)) |\n| **E4B (4-5B)** | ~4-6 GB | ~6-8 GB | ~9-15 GB ([avenchat.com](https://avenchat.com/blog/gemma-4-hardware-requirements?utm_source=openai)) |\n| **26B MoE** | ~15-20 GB | ~25-28 GB | ~50-54 GB ([compute-market.com](https://www.compute-market.com/blog/gemma-4-local-hardware-guide-2026?utm_source=openai)) |\n| **31B Dense** | ~18-22 GB | ~30-35 GB | ~60-62 GB ([gemmai4.com](https://gemmai4.com/vram/?utm_source=openai)) |\n\n---\n\n### System RAM & CPU\n\n- For smaller models (E2B / E4B), **~8\u201316 GB system RAM** is usable as minimum (especially if quantized). ([oflight.co.jp](https://www.oflight.co.jp/en/columns/gemma-4-complete-requirements-reference-vram-ram-gpu-2026?utm_source=openai))  \n- Larger models (26B MoE / 31B) will need **16-32 GB or more RAM**, particularly to accommodate not just model weights but also runtime overhead (the KV cache, OS, etc.). ([oflight.co.jp](https://www.oflight.co.jp/en/columns/gemma4-hardware-requirements-local-ai-spec-2026?utm_source=openai))  \n- A fast CPU helps with offloading some work if GPU is limited; but GPU or unified memory (for Apple Silicon) is strongly preferred for anything beyond the tiny models. ([oflight.co.jp](https://www.oflight.co.jp/en/columns/gemma4-hardware-requirements-local-ai-spec-2026?utm_source=openai))  \n\n---\n\n### GPU & VRAM Recommendations\n\nHere are practical \u201csweet spots\u201d for GPU/VRAM depending on the model you want to run: ([craftrigs.com](https://craftrigs.com/articles/67-gemma-4-gpu-sweet-spot-2026/?utm_source=openai))\n\n| Hardware Tier | What You Can Run Comfortably |\n|---|---|\n| **~6-8 GB VRAM** (mid-entry GPUs) | E2B at Q4; maybe E4B at lower precision / shorter context windows. ([avenchat.com](https://avenchat.com/blog/gemma-4-hardware-requirements?utm_source=openai)) |\n| **10-16 GB VRAM** | E4B (Q8 or Q4) comfortably; possibly 26B MoE (Q4) with careful settings. ([avenchat.com](https://avenchat.com/blog/gemma-4-hardware-requirements?utm_source=openai)) |\n| **20-24 GB VRAM** | Good fit for 31B Dense (Q4) or 26B MoE; supports longer contexts. ([craftrigs.com](https://craftrigs.com/articles/67-gemma-4-gpu-sweet-spot-2026/?utm_source=openai)) |\n| **48-80+ GB VRAM** | Full precision BF16 / FP16 for large models; enterprise / server-grade setups. ([oflight.co.jp](https://www.oflight.co.jp/en/columns/gemma4-hardware-requirements-local-ai-spec-2026?utm_source=openai)) |\n\n---\n\n## Context Windows & Extra Overhead\n\n- The **context window** (length of text/history + multimodal inputs) significantly increases memory demands due to the KV cache. Larger windows (128K or 256K tokens) can require **several additional GB** beyond the model weight itself. ([compute-market.com](https://www.compute-market.com/blog/gemma-4-local-hardware-guide-2026?utm_source=openai))  \n- Use quantization (4-bit or 8-bit) to reduce weight size; runtime libraries like `llama.cpp`, `Ollama`, or \u201cUnsloth\u201d help manage memory. ([localaimaster.com](https://localaimaster.com/blog/gemma-local-setup-guide?utm_source=openai))\n\n---\n\n## Summary: What You\u2019d Need Locally\n\nHere's a quick cheat sheet:\n\n- If you want something lightweight: **E2B or E4B at Q4** precision. Results: ~2-6 GB VRAM; 8-16 GB system RAM; even modest GPU or Apple Silicon works.  \n- If you want more power & multimodal abilities but still \u201cdesktop class\u201d: **26B MoE (Q4)** with ~20-25 GB VRAM and 16-32 GB RAM.  \n- If you're aiming for \u201cflagship\u201d performance / dense model + long context: **31B Dense (Q4 or BF16)** which demands ~20-25 GB or more VRAM, and ideally a workstation GPU with 24 GB+ VRAM (or Apple Silicon / cloud setup).  \n\n---\n\nIf you tell me your hardware (GPU, VRAM, RAM, CPU, OS), I can suggest which Gemma variant would run best *for you*."
    }
]